Understanding ADHD Treatment Options: A Comprehensive Guide

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a common neurodevelopmental condition affecting both children and adults. Identified by symptoms such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ity, ADHD can substantially impact numerous elements of life, consisting of academic efficiency, work performance, and social relationships. Fortunately, a variety of efficient treatment alternatives are available to manage symptoms and enhance general performance. This post dives into various ADHD treatment alternatives, exploring their efficiency, benefits, and prospective drawbacks.

1. Medication Options

Stimulant Medications

Stimulant medications are frequently the first line of treatment for ADHD. They work by increasing levels of neurotransmitters in the brain, improving focus and self-control.

Medication Name Common Brand Names Common Dosage Potential Side Effects
Methylphenidate Ritalin, Concerta 5-60 mg/day Sleeping disorders, loss of cravings, anxiety
Amphetamine Adderall, Vyvanse 5-70 mg/day Sleeping disorders, increased heart rate, irritability

Non-Stimulant Medications

For some people, non-stimulant medications may be better suited. They are frequently utilized when stimulants trigger excruciating adverse effects or when there’s a history of compound abuse.

Medication Name Typical Brand Names Typical Dosage Possible Side Effects
Atomoxetine Strattera 10-100 mg/day Tiredness, gastrointestinal issues
Guanfacine Intuniv 1-4 mg/day Drowsiness, low blood pressure

2. Behavioral Therapies

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)

CBT is a structured, time-limited treatment that focuses on changing unfavorable thought patterns and behaviors. It can help individuals with ADHD handle their signs more successfully.

Benefits of CBT:

  • Helps establish coping techniques
  • Enhances organizational abilities
  • Enhances self-confidence

Moms And Dad Training and Behavioral Interventions

Behavioral methods frequently involve training for parents, enabling them to implement efficient techniques to manage their child’s behavior.

Secret Components:

  • Positive support
  • Clear expectations and repercussions
  • Constant routines

3. Lifestyle Changes

Dietary Modifications

Some research studies suggest that dietary modifications may assist handle ADHD symptoms. While more research is required, certain dietary techniques include:

  • Omega-3 Fatty Acids: Found in fish oil, they may improve focus.
  • Elimination Diets: Identifying food level of sensitivities can help minimize symptoms.
  • Balanced Diet: A diet rich in whole foods can normally support brain health.

Workout and Sleep

Regular exercise and appropriate sleep hygiene are vital for managing ADHD signs.

  • Workout: Regular aerobic workout may improve concentration, motivation, and state of mind.
  • Sleep Hygiene: Establishing a consistent sleep schedule can minimize daytime sleepiness and enhance attention.

4. Alternative Treatments

Mindfulness and Meditation

Mindfulness practices, including meditation and yoga, have acquired traction as complementary treatments for ADHD. These strategies can enhance self-awareness, enhance psychological policy, and decrease impulsivity.

Benefits:

  • Reduces stress and stress and anxiety
  • Enhances attention span
  • Promotes relaxation

Neurofeedback

Neurofeedback is a kind of biofeedback that teaches individuals to manage brain activity. It aims to enhance brain areas connected with attention and impulse control.

Possible Benefits:

  • Non-invasive and drug-free
  • Can lead to long-lasting enhancements in symptoms
  • Tailored to individual brain patterns

5.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How do I understand which treatment is best for my kid?

A: Consulting with a health care professional, such as a pediatrician or psychiatrist concentrated on ADHD, is crucial. They can supply a tailored treatment strategy based upon your child’s specific signs and needs.

Q2: Are medications needed for handling ADHD?

A: Medications can be extremely efficient, however they are not the only option. Many individuals benefit from behavior modifications and lifestyle changes alone. It’s important to discuss all available alternatives with a health care supplier.

Q3: What are the long-lasting effects of ADHD medications?

A: Most studies show that medications are safe and effective when kept an eye on by a health care provider. Nevertheless, potential negative effects should be talked about, and routine follow-ups are required to assess their impact.

Q4: Can way of life changes alone help manage ADHD?

A: While way of life changes can significantly help manage signs, they are typically most effective when combined with behavior modifications or medications. Each individual’s action differs.

Q5: Is ADHD treatment a one-size-fits-all method?

A: No, treatment for ADHD is highly customized. What works for someone might not be efficient for another. A comprehensive evaluation and ongoing evaluation are vital for optimal treatment.


Coping with ADHD can be tough, but different treatment choices exist to assist handle signs effectively. From medication and behavior modifications to lifestyle modifications and alternative treatments, people can find a combination that works for them. The secret to successful management often depends on a personalized technique directed by health care specialists. Open conversations about treatment can cause enhanced outcomes and a better quality of life for those impacted by ADHD.
